    I flash the ROM in Clockwork Recovery, then instead of letting it reboot, I pull the battery and boot into hboot (bootloader) and flash the radio.

    Pull battery, reinsert, hold volume down while pressing power until hboot comes up.

    Quote Originally Posted by slim6596 View Post
    Just make sure that, before you go to reboot into recovery to flash the ROM, that you have the correct radio file on the root of your sdcard (not in a folder), and that it's named correctly.
    The named correctly thing has me confused. Is that the PG015img thing that i see on here a lot and used to root? Like do i need to rename the radio and if so, how do i know what name?

    It's always the same name. PG05IMG.zip. The thing that gets some people is that some versions of Windows hide known extensions, such as .zip Many were naming the file manually to PG05IMG.zip, not knowing that since it was already a zip file, it meant that the file's new name became PG05IMG.zip.zip

    Most ROM developers will post a link to the recommended radio file in the thread where they have the link for downloading the ROM.
